DOE: US average EV CO2e/year is 4,815 lbs, vs. 11,435 lbs for average gasoline car

Green Car Congress

Using electricity production data by source and state, the DOE’s Alternative Fuels Data Center has estimated the annual carbon dioxide (CO 2 e)-equivalent emissions of a typical EV. EVs charging in Vermont are estimated to produce the fewest emissions—oil and gas make up only 1.2% Source: DOE. Click to enlarge.

UPS hits target of 1 billion alternative-fueled miles one year early

Green Car Congress

UPS has achieved its goal of driving 1 billion miles in its alternative fuel and advanced technology fleet one year earlier than planned, and marked more than 10 years of learning from its “Rolling Laboratory” of now more than 7,200 alternative fuel vehicles. Adapt and tailor the solution.

Virginia Governor signs legislation and executive order beginning transition of state vehicles to natural gas, electricity or other alternative fuels

Green Car Congress

Virginia Governor Bob McDonnell has signed two pieces of legislation that promote the use of natural gas, electric or other alternative-fueled vehicles in the Commonwealth. Jasper Alternate Fuels Adds Icom JTG Propane Engine System

Green Car Congress

Jasper Alternate Fuels, a division of Jasper Engines & Transmissions, has signed an agreement with Icom North America to install and service Icom’s patented JTG propane liquid-injection fuel system on commercial fleet vehicles in North America. It offers alternative fuel systems for vehicle fleets of any size.

GM to introduce CNG-gasoline bi-fuel Chevrolet Impala in US next summer

Green Car Congress

General Motors will build a Chevrolet Impala sedan for retail and fleet customers that operates on either gasoline or compressed natural gas (CNG), GM Chairman and CEO Dan Akerson announced today. This will be the only manufacturer-produced full-size bi-fuel sedan in the US, and is expected to go on sale next summer as a 2015 model.
